Fastned’s Expansion into Italy
Fastned has opened its first DC fast-charging station in Italy, equipped with up to 400 kW chargers. This recent development marks an important milestone in Fastned’s expansion strategy, bringing its cutting-edge DC fast-charging technology to the Italian market.

Boosting EV Adoption in Italy
The introduction of Fastned’s fast-charging station can catalyze EV adoption in Italy. By providing reliable and efficient charging solutions, Fastned can help to alleviate range anxiety, one of the main barriers to EV adoption.
Promoting Cross-Border EV Usage
By expanding its network to Italy, Fastned is facilitating cross-border EV usage. The unified charging standard applied across Fastned’s network makes it possible for EV drivers to travel across different countries without worrying about compatibility issues at charging stations.
